Default hermit crabs?

My LFS guy just advised me not to get any hermit crabs and stick strickly with snails? He said they will eventually eat my snails. Has anyone else heard this or follows this train of thought?

Default Re: hermit crabs?

Crabs can eat snails if the crab is very big and the snail is small... happend to me only once... the snail had fallen on its back and couldnt get up and a large hermit came along and killed it... a couple of days latter it was walking around with a new house on his back.... guess wich one. but if your snails are a god size and your hermits and of normal size (mine was freakin huge) youll be ok.

Most hermit crabs will eat snails if they are not fed properly. THey also like to eat snails if they have have out grown thier shelkls. I like hermits thoug, i feel they are worth it for there scavaging duties.

Default Re: hermit crabs?

Size isnt as important as species...I have found that the larger hermit crabs like the marshal islands blue knuckle can coexist very peacfully if fed regularly with seaweed and krill. You just have to make sure that everything like LR and coral frags or colonies are secure. I have had a fairly large blue knuckle hermit in my 12 gallon reef for about a year now. If you feed them they are usually fine. But there are many preditorial species that are quite "evil" in reefs. Here's a pic of one of mine.....
